PRESIDENT RICHARD II called on Past President Richard I for another joke, and there were many "fine moments". Sgt-at-Arms Doug Cargo tried to emulate ROTOPIG.
PRESIDENT RICHARD II called for a standup Board meeting of the McCall Foundation after the regular meeting and was fined for malfeasance in office. Tom Rodgers reported that the CCCC Blood drive netted 143 pints and we are up to 386 so far. George Elking called for help in placing the Christmas Cops Toy Boxes out for collections. David Marks reminded us of the USMC "TOYS FOR TOTS" MOTORCYCLE RUN on Saturday, December 1st. <LINK>. Richard Butterly called for the Thanksgiving Volunteers to meet at Poor Richard's Thanksgiving morning at 10 am.
ABSENT WERE Steve Blair, Matt Brown, Rick Chron, David Daniels, Reeves Davis, Pat Hite, Rod Hogan, Bud McBrayer, Don Mellor, Bill Peterson, John Roach, Brenda Rogers, Shep Stahel and Richard Wells.
RUDELY [OR POLITELY?] LEAVING EARLY was John Payton at 7:44:44 am CST. TODAY'S PROGRAM, introduced by Paul Huang, was Bob Bare from Hearing Haven <LINK>. Bob told us about "How To Get People to Listen to You". As is our custom, a book was donated in the speaker's name to the Nellie McCall Library at the David McCall Elementary School and duly signed by him. The book was "Over the River and Through the Wood" by Lydia Child. <LINK>
